Artificial intelligence, often referred to as AI, is a branch of computer science that aims to create intelligent machines capable of performing tasks that typically require human intelligence. In the realm of game development, AI is being used to enhance player experiences, improve game mechanics, and create more dynamic and engaging gameplay elements. UK startup assistantship programs are increasingly leveraging AI technologies to provide aspiring game developers with the tools and resources needed to succeed in the competitive gaming industry. By integrating AI into their programs, startups can offer participants valuable hands-on experience in developing AI-powered games while also gaining insights into the latest trends and innovations in the field. One of the key benefits of using AI in assistantship programs is the ability to automate certain aspects of game development, allowing developers to focus on more creative and strategic tasks. AI algorithms can be used to generate procedural content, optimize game difficulty levels, and even create realistic non-player characters (NPCs) that adapt to players' actions. Moreover, AI can be utilized in playtesting and player behavior analysis, helping developers gather valuable data and feedback to refine their games and deliver a more personalized gaming experience. By incorporating AI-powered analytics tools, startups can track player engagement, identify patterns in user behavior, and make data-driven decisions to improve their games' performance and profitability. Furthermore, AI can empower game developers to explore new design possibilities and push the boundaries of traditional game development. From creating dynamic environments that evolve based on player interactions to implementing machine learning algorithms that personalize gameplay experiences, the applications of AI in game development are vast and transformative.
